PTFE Convoluted Tubing
Corrugated PTFE hose that is extremely flexible and ideal for applications requiring a tighter bend radius, higher pressure capacity or improved crush resistance.

Product Overview
Product specification
- Meets specifications: FDA 21 CFR 177.1550, USP Class VI, UL 94 V-0, AS 81914, ASTM D3296
- Product type: Only dimensionally compatible with AS 81914, PTFE Low Profile, PTFE CONVO-TEX
- Areas of use: Fluid handling, medical use, instrumentation, pharmaceutical industry, food & beverage, industrial manufacturing, packaging
- Inner diameter of the hose: 0.135 to 4 inches, 3.5 to 102 mm
- Outer diameter of the hose: 0.235 to 4.75 inches, 5.9 to 120.6 mm
- Maximum working pressure: not applicable
- Minimum burst pressure: not applicable
- Maximum working temperature: 392 to 500 °F, 200 to 260 °C
- Minimum working temperature: -100 °F, -73 °C
- Minimum bending radius: 3/8 to 9 inches, 9.5 to 228.6 mm
- Compatible couplings: Compression, Compress-Align®, Flow Controls, TrueSeal™, Prestolok®
- Medium: Air, chemicals, water
- Color: Black, natural color
- Weight: 0.008 to 1,160 kg/m, 0.007 to 1,559 lb/ft
- Hose material: Pol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E)
- Size: 1/8 to 4 inches
- Length per package: Depending on item number (feet and meters)
- The inner diameter of the cuff: 1/8 to 4 inches, 3.2 to 101.6 mm
- Cuff length: 3/4 to 2-1/2 inches, 19 to 64 mm

Features/benefits
- Low coefficient of friction
- Moisture retention less than 0,01 %
- Excellent bending strength
- Low porosity
- Very large range of sizes from 1/8” inner diameter to 4” outer diameter
- Wire reinforcement available for increased vacuum applications or when a tighter bending radius is needed
- Available in split hose design

Technical specifications
- Extruded from pure PTFE (polytetrafluoroethylene)
- Standard pipes are supplied in natural color, with the exception of part number 81914. These are supplied in black pigmented color unless otherwise specified. Additional colors are available on request.
- Dense convolution constructions are available.
- Sleeves are available to create an attachable end to add couplings or flanges. See catalog 4660 for more information.
- The stock packaging is random rolls.
